A Basic Guide to Flat Roof Inspections

January 21, 2025/in Uncategorized/by Arocon

Need to keep your flat roof in good shape? A basic guide to flat roof inspections will show you how to detect leaks, check drainage, and spot material wear. Regular inspections are key to prolonging your roof’s life and ensuring it stays in great condition.

Understanding Flat Roofs

Flat roofs have unique design and maintenance requirements. Unlike pitched roofs, their level surface can make drainage challenging. Common materials like TPO, EPDM, and gravel each have distinct characteristics and benefits. Routine inspections identify and address issues promptly, ensuring the roof’s integrity and longevity.

Detecting leaks in flat roofs is challenging because water can travel long distances beneath the material before surfacing. Proper maintenance, including regular cleaning to prevent debris accumulation and ensure proper drainage, can help flat roofs last beyond their typical 15-year lifespan. Understanding these aspects is key for effective maintenance and prevention of potential issues.

Common Issues Found in Flat Roofs

Common issues found in flat roofs, depicting various roof damages.

Flat roofs are susceptible to various issues that can compromise their effectiveness and lifespan. Common problems include inadequate drainage, leading to water pooling and material breakdown. Leaks are a significant concern due to the flat surface’s difficulty in draining water effectively. Regular inspections diagnose potential drainage issues, preventing pooling water and damage.

Standing water on flat roofs can cause structural damage and promote mold growth. Regular maintenance prevents these issues and enhances the longevity of flat roofs.

Signs of Water Damage

Water damage on flat roofs can appear in various forms, and early detection is crucial to prevent further complications. Water stains on ceilings are a clear sign of potential leaks from the roof above. These stains can vary in size and severity but should never be ignored.

Leaks are another common indicator of water damage. Addressing leaks promptly prevents further damage to the roof and building structure. Regular inspections help identify these signs early, ensuring water damage does not escalate into more significant issues.

Drainage System Problems

Inadequate drainage is a common issue with flat roofs, leading to water pooling and damage. Ponding water indicates drainage problems and suggests the system is not functioning correctly. Ensuring proper water flow prevents leaks and structural damage.

Regularly clearing debris from gutters, drains, and scuppers ensures proper drainage. Inspect the system for blockages or damage, especially after storms. Maintaining a clean and functional drainage system prevents water pooling and costly repairs.

Material Degradation

Different roofing materials degrade at different rates, and understanding these patterns is crucial for timely maintenance. Materials like TPO and EPDM have specific wear patterns indicating the need for repair or replacement. Inspections should check the condition of the roof membrane and identify signs of wear or damage.

Debris accumulation accelerates material degradation, so keeping the roof clean is essential. Regular maintenance and timely repairs significantly extend the life of your flat roof, preventing extensive damage and costly repairs.

How to Perform a Basic Flat Roof Inspection

How to perform a basic flat roof inspection with an inspector examining a roof.

Performing a basic flat roof inspection involves several key steps and tools. Safety is paramount, so use proper safety gear before climbing onto the roof. Inspections are best conducted during clear skies and dry conditions to avoid slipping and ensure a thorough examination.

A physical inspection involves visually examining the roof surface for signs of damage, structural soundness, and the condition of the roofing materials during roofing inspections. Essential tools include ladders, inspection tools, and measurement instruments for accurate assessment.

Exterior Inspection

During an exterior inspection of a flat roof, check for damage such as cracks, blisters, punctures, and the condition of the roof membrane, flashing, and seams, as well as the integrity of the exterior walls. Look for irregularities on the roof surface, including loose or missing materials, protruding nails, soft spots, and sagging. Regular cleaning prevents water accumulation, which can lead to leaks and damage.

Inspect seals around pipes and other roof penetrations to prevent leaks and premature wear. Keeping the roof clean and free of debris prevents blockages and ensures proper drainage. Regular inspections and maintenance identify and address potential issues before they become major problems.

Interior Inspection

An interior inspection identifies signs of water damage inside the building. Look for visible water stains on ceilings, which often indicate ongoing leaks requiring prompt attention. The presence of mold on interior walls can also signal underlying water damage affecting the roof. Timely repairs of minor issues identified during inspections prevent more extensive damage later.

Inspect attic spaces for signs of moisture intrusion and insulation damage. A musty smell inside the home strongly indicates mold or mildew resulting from water damage in the roof. Addressing these issues promptly prevents further damage and maintains the integrity of your roofing system.

Seasonal Checks

Seasonal checks ensure your roof remains in good condition throughout the year. The best times to schedule a roof inspection are early fall and early spring, as these seasons provide ideal weather conditions for thorough inspections. Conduct regular roof inspections at least once a year, with commercial roofs needing inspection twice a year.

Schedule an inspection after severe weather events to identify any potential damage. Regular inspections prepare your roof to withstand severe weather by identifying and reinforcing vulnerable areas. This proactive approach saves you from costly repairs and extends the life of your flat roof.

Maintenance Tips to Extend the Life of Your Flat Roof

Maintaining a flat roof through regular inspections and timely repairs significantly extends its lifespan. Regular maintenance identifies and addresses wear and tear promptly, ensuring the roof remains in good condition.

Here are practical tips to help you maintain your flat roof and prevent costly repairs.

Regular Cleaning

Routine cleaning is essential for keeping your flat roof in good shape. Accumulated debris and vegetation can cause blockages and water pooling. Regularly removing debris prevents mold and algae growth, enhancing the roof’s aesthetic appeal and functionality.

Maintaining a clean roof also prevents UV damage, which can cause premature degradation of roofing materials. Keeping your roof clean ensures it remains in good shape and provides long-term protection for your property.

Routine Repairs

Timely roof repairs prevent more extensive and costly damage. Roof repair costs usually range between $400 and $2,000, depending on damage severity. Addressing minor issues promptly prevents them from developing into major problems that require costly repairs.

Regular inspections identify minor issues early, allowing you to take action before they escalate. Staying on top of routine repairs maintains the integrity of your roofing system and extends its lifespan.

Protective Coatings

Protective coatings significantly enhance the durability of a flat roof by providing an extra layer of protection against environmental factors. Various types of coatings, including reflective ones, reduce heat absorption and cool the building. These coatings extend the roof’s life and improve its aesthetic appeal, allowing homeowners to customize the look of their roofing system.

Proper application involves cleaning the roof surface thoroughly, applying an appropriate primer if necessary, and ensuring even coverage for optimal protection. Hiring a professional ensures the coatings are applied correctly, providing maximum benefits and longevity for your flat roof.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should I inspect my flat roof?

You should inspect your flat roof at least once a year and immediately after severe weather events to identify and address any potential issues promptly. Regular inspections help maintain the roof’s integrity and longevity.

What are the common signs of water damage on a flat roof?

Common signs of water damage on a flat roof include visible water stains on ceilings, leaks, and the growth of mold or mildew indoors. Addressing these issues promptly is essential to prevent further damage.

How can I ensure proper drainage on my flat roof?

To ensure proper drainage on your flat roof, regularly clear debris from gutters, drains, and scuppers, and inspect for blockages or damage, particularly after storms. This maintenance will help prevent water pooling and potential roof damage.

When should I call a professional roofing contractor?

You should call a professional roofing contractor when you notice signs of leaks, extensive damage, or if you need a comprehensive evaluation of your roof. Timely intervention can prevent further issues and ensure your roof remains structurally sound.

What are the benefits of applying protective coatings to my flat roof?

Applying protective coatings to your flat roof significantly enhances its durability and shields it from environmental factors while improving energy efficiency by reducing heat absorption. This proactive measure can lead to longer roof life and lower energy costs.
